Income Tax (Earnings and Pensions) Act 2003 section 308A

Exemption of contributions to overseas pension scheme

Section 308A provides an income tax exemption for employer contributions made to a qualifying overseas pension scheme on behalf of an employee who is a relevant migrant member of that scheme.

  • Employer contributions to a qualifying overseas pension scheme are exempt from income tax as earnings of the employee
  • The exemption only applies where the employee is a relevant migrant member of the pension scheme
  • A qualifying overseas pension scheme and relevant migrant member are concepts defined in Schedule 33 to the Finance Act 2004, which deals with migrant member relief for overseas pension schemes
  • The exemption ensures that employees who have moved to the UK and remain members of an overseas pension scheme are not taxed on their employer's ongoing contributions to that scheme
